css点击事件(css3点击事件)
简介:
在网页开发中,我们经常需要对页面中的元素进行交互操作,而点击事件是其中最为常见的一种。CSS提供了多种方式来实现点击事件的效果,可以轻松地帮助开发人员实现各种按钮、导航等交互效果。
多级标题:
一、CSS实现点击事件的基本方式
二、使用CSS实现按钮点击效果
三、使用CSS实现下拉菜单点击效果
四、使用CSS实现模态框点击效果
五、使用CSS实现全屏幕遮罩层点击效果
内容详细说明:
一、CSS实现点击事件的基本方式
使用CSS实现点击事件最常用的方式是通过伪类选择器:hover和:focus。其中:hover可以让元素在鼠标悬停时发生变化,而:focus则可以让元素在被选中时发生变化。通过使用这两个选择器,开发人员可以轻松地实现各种点击事件的效果。
二、使用CSS实现按钮点击效果
按钮是网页中最为常见的交互元素之一。在使用CSS实现按钮点击效果时,可以使用:hover和:active伪元素。通过:hover可以让按钮在鼠标悬停时发生一些变化,而通过:active可以让按钮在鼠标点击时发生变化。通过这两个伪元素的组合,可以轻松实现各种按钮点击效果。
三、使用CSS实现下拉菜单点击效果
下拉菜单是网页中常用的导航元素之一。在使用CSS实现下拉菜单点击效果时,可以利用:hover和:focus伪类选择器。通过:hover可以让菜单在鼠标悬停时显示出来,而通过:focus可以让菜单在被选中时显示出来。通过这两个伪类选择器的配合,可以实现各种下拉菜单点击效果。
四、使用CSS实现模态框点击效果
模态框是网页中常用的弹窗元素之一。在使用CSS实现模态框点击效果时,可以利用:checked伪类选择器。:checked可以让模态框在被选中时显示出来,而通过:checked的配合可以实现各种模态框点击效果。
五、使用CSS实现全屏幕遮罩层点击效果
在网页中需要实现全屏遮罩层的交互效果时,可以使用CSS的:checked和:before伪元素以及z-index属性等。通过:checked可以让遮罩层在被选中时显示出来,而通过:before可以让遮罩层的内容显示出来。通过这些元素的组合,可以轻松实现全屏幕遮罩层的点击效果。
总结:
CSS提供了多种方式来实现点击事件的效果,可以用来实现各种交互元素的效果,包括按钮、下拉菜单、模态框以及全屏幕遮罩层等。熟练掌握这些技术能够为我们开发高质量的网页提供很大的帮助。